Leona and the Solari Faith

Leona was born on Mount Targon to Sunforgers Iasur and Melia. She grew up among the Rakkor people, raised in strict service to the Solari. The Solari worship the sun as the ultimate source of truth and order, and Leona accepted this belief without doubt.

From an early age, she showed exceptional discipline and strength. Her devotion, skill, and resolve set her apart from her peers. Many believed she was destined to join the Ra’Horak, the elite warrior order of the Solari.

Her faith shaped her sense of duty. Leona believed the sun’s light revealed all truths and guided those who followed it.

Leona and Diana: Bond and Betrayal

A Friendship That Defied Doctrine

The Solari once took in an orphan named Diana. Unlike Leona, Diana questioned Solari teachings and felt drawn to the moon and night. This made her an outcast, often punished for her beliefs.

Leona saw Diana as someone lost, not corrupt. She offered kindness where others showed cruelty. Over time, the two grew close, forming a bond that went beyond friendship.

The Hidden Truth of Mount Targon

Diana later shared a secret with Leona. She had discovered a hidden alcove within Mount Targon. Its walls showed ancient images of moon worship and silver-clad figures. These images suggested the sun and moon were once united, not enemies.

Leona feared for Diana’s safety. She urged her to abandon the discovery and stay silent. Diana agreed, though her doubts remained. Leona believed she had protected her friend from severe punishment.

The Ascent of Mount Targon

A Trial of Will and Survival

One night, Leona saw Diana leave the temple in secret. Instead of alerting the elders, she followed her. Leona chose loyalty to her friend over obedience to doctrine.

The climb up Mount Targon tested her beyond all limits. She passed frozen bodies of those who had failed before her. Pain, exhaustion, and cold pressed against her resolve. She endured through discipline and sheer will.

The Moment of Ascension

At the summit, Leona found Diana engulfed in silver light. Diana screamed in agony as the power of the moon took hold. Leona rushed forward to help.

At that moment, a second column of golden light descended. The power of the sun surrounded Leona, burning through her body and spirit. She expected death. Instead, she emerged transformed.

Leona became the new Aspect of the Sun.

Leona as the Aspect of the Sun

Bearing the Burden of the Sun

The sun’s power did not erase Leona’s identity. Her will anchored her consciousness as the Aspect bonded with her. Golden armor formed around her body, and her weapons appeared in her hands.

Diana also survived, reborn as the Aspect of the Moon. She wore silver armor that mirrored Leona’s gold. Diana felt hope in their shared transformation and asked Leona to leave the Solari behind.

Leona refused. She demanded they return and face judgment. Their argument turned into battle, fueled by celestial power. Diana gained the upper hand but could not strike the final blow. She fled instead.

Leona returned alone.

The Cost of Loyalty

When Leona reached the Solari settlement, she found devastation. Priests and warriors lay dead, seemingly slain by Diana. The survivors looked to Leona as a symbol of salvation.

As the Aspect of the Sun, Leona accepted her role as protector and leader. She believed great change was coming and prepared to guide her people through it.

Leadership and Modern Role

Leona rose to command the Ra’Horak. Every Solari warrior answered to her authority. She became both a spiritual symbol and a military leader.

She remains loyal to Solari dominance but fears what Diana may become if left unchecked. Leona still cares for Diana and seeks to help her control the moon’s power. This inner conflict defines much of her path.

Her leadership is strict but driven by duty rather than cruelty.

Personality and Appearance

Leona is tall and imposing, with lightly tanned skin and long auburn hair. Her red and gold armor reflects Solari craftsmanship and celestial power. A spiked golden crown marks her as an Aspect.

Her personality centers on devotion and resolve. She is willing to sacrifice herself for her people. Her warmth appears most clearly in her feelings for Diana, whom she still loves despite their conflict.

This mix of compassion and rigid belief makes Leona both noble and tragic.

Leona’s Powers and Abilities

Aspect Host Physiology

As the host of the Aspect of the Sun, Leona possesses enhanced strength, speed, and endurance. She feels little pain, resists sickness, and ages far more slowly than mortals.

Her body channels solar power without breaking under its force.

Solar Magic

Leona commands solar energy through her connection to the Aspect. She can call down solar flares from the sky and infuse her weapons with burning light. This magic sears enemies and reinforces her defenses.

Her powers reflect the sun’s nature: relentless and revealing.

Combat Training

Leona trained with the Ra’Horak from a young age. Her discipline and technique made her a master long before her ascension. This training allows her to wield her Aspect powers with control rather than chaos.

Zenith Blade and Shield of Daybreak

The Zenith Blade and Shield of Daybreak appeared when Leona became an Aspect. Both are bound to her celestial role.

The Zenith Blade radiates heat and light capable of burning through flesh and armor. The Shield of Daybreak creates barriers of solar energy and emits intense heat and light. Together, they form the core of her combat style.

Leona on the Rift

Leona’s abilities reflect her lore. She excels at engaging enemies, controlling fights, and protecting allies. Her power peaks when she stays close to enemies, absorbing damage while locking targets in place.

Her strength lies in timing and positioning. Once she commits, retreat is difficult, both for her and her enemies.

Relationships with Other Champions

Leona’s strongest bond remains with Diana. Their shared past and opposing Aspects place them on different paths, yet their connection endures.

She also clashes with Atreus, the mortal host of the Aspect of War. His rejection of the Aspects puts him at odds with her beliefs.

Soraka recognizes Leona’s celestial presence, referring to her as a woman whose face burned like the sun.
